James Lee was transported on the Maria Somes, departing 22nd Apr 1844 and arriving 30th Jul 1844 with 264 passengers.

Convict Notes




Place of origin: Stratford upon Avon, Warwickshire 1873 - Pauper Interments. Thomas Lee. Inquest held 1 July 1873 on the 19 June 1873 was in Hobart Town. 1873 - INQUEST. Name: Lee, Thomas Age: 48. Also known as: Lee, James Ship to colony: Maria Somes (1) Remarks: Free by Servitude Date of inquest: 1 Jul 1873. Verdict: Found drowned Record ID:NAME_INDEXES:1360137 Resource: POL709/1/10 p.127 (1873) & SC195/1/56 Inquest 7219




James received his ticket of leave in 1849 it was revoked 27\1\1852. Received ticket of leave again in 27\9\1853 then a conditional pardon 1854. He was found drowned in the Derwent River 29\6\1873.
